Abstract
This researcher aims to find out how mature the implementation of an electronic-based government system is in service by using the Village Development Index application in Tapos I Village, Tenjolaya District, Bogor Regency, West Java Province. The research method used was qualitative to understand the abilities that were able to be carried out by the research subjects, while the data collection techniques used observation, interviews and documentation studies. Data analysis techniques used are data collection, data reduction, data presentation, and drawing conclusions. Then the data validation techniques used were research triangulation, methodological triangulation and theoretical triangulation. The results of the study show that the Implementation of an Electronic-Based Government System (SPBE) in Village Services through the Development of the Village Building Index Application. What is said is the Development Village Index (IDM) by showing the level of independence of the village with the IDM application by looking at the human and economic resources of the community as well as network constraints that are not strong so that the input of IDM data is hampered, the application is still constrained when the data transmission process is interrupted by the program itself, this happens when the server, especially the Village Development Index application, not only 1 village uses the IDM application but all villages in Indonesia. Tapos I Village is still classified as a developed village with an IDM score of 0.7614. For this reason, the Tapos I Village government seeks to increase the potential of its human resources and improve the community's economy in the field of food security and fisheries.
